Output ecfc8c29f2fe7f14af969242d8883c9550dfc6cf47ee26286dc2a35bbccd4c93:1

value
43490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b2a7d86dfcc3fd38c6188277f7832a4aa79463c OP_EQUAL
address
35dFt5Bo6T1v1vz8tF8P49ik7uFDaqVKfV
transaction
ecfc8c29f2fe7f14af969242d8883c9550dfc6cf47ee26286dc2a35bbccd4c93